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, there was a requirement for the school to make a variation to the Admissions Policy for 2021 with regards to students applying under category D, E and F in our supplementary application form (children on the Anglican faith, children and/or their parent(s) who attend a church of another Christian denomination, and children and/or their parent(s) who are active members of the other major world faiths).

Last week, we were informed by the Education and Skills Funding Agency (EFSA) that our variation had been approved. More details about the variation can be found in the policy and supplementary application form, which can be found on our website: www.trinityhigh.com/admissions
